光气与联乙酰和亚磷酸三甲酯制得的氧代磷烷反应生成α-(二甲基磷酸)-β-酮酰氯,在催化下分子内损失氯甲烷。由CuSO 4,并产生第一个报道的5元环式磷酸酯。磷酰基磷仅以极快的速度受到水,醇和酚的磷攻击。相反,叔胺仅攻击酰基磷酸的外环OMe基团的Me碳,以产生5元环状酰基磷酸的季铵盐。这些磷酸的环状混合酸酐是目前已知的最有效的含氧亲核试剂的磷酸化剂。磷酸化的最终产物是磷酸三酯,磷酸二酯和磷酸单酯,它们含有易于除去的乙酰乙酰基,[(CH 3 CO)(CH 3)CHO] P(O)(OR)(OR')。
